True Leaf Studio Neighborhood: Denton 301 S. Locust St.,, TX 940-218-1133 Website Best Of Dallas Observer® Awards 2024 Best Place To Buy Plants, Build a Terrarium and Get a Tattoo advertisement advertisement Trending Concerts The Dallas Concerts to Look Forward to This Fall By Eric Diep Technology New Law Requires App Stores To Card Users By Alyssa Fields Restaurants The Best Desserts in Dallas By Lauren Drewes Daniels Weather New Dallas Winter Weather Outlook Released By Kelly Dearmore